The third one was a seedling, Larry told me whos it was but I forget. It could very well be registered now, Larry started all this several years ago. Larry and Bill work pretty close together and both are really good at doing conversions. Larry has shown me the hold process, but being I am leaning more and more toward dips, well you know. Its a very expensive process also. First you have to have enough plants to start, most will die from the treatment or not work, then you baby sit them for several weeks keeping them at the correct temp. and moisture. Then to sell one you have to increase them making sure they don't revert back.

Living in Paradise arrived yesterday—a large, husky, two-fan plant, along with a generous bonus double-fan of the aptly-named Unexpected Mysteries. It was a total surprise in many ways, and really made my day. When I ordered a couple of weeks ago, I asked them to ship ASAP, because I can plant any time, and they actually took me up on it. It's my first order from Graceland, and I couldn't be more pleased.

I think that this is the perfect time to "spring" plant in my climate, but most growers are reluctant or unable to ship out-of-season. Experience has shown me that these will perform far better than plants dug and shipped in March or later, since they will have more time to re-establish before the late spring above-ground growth spurt.
